Removing PCI I/O Cards

CAUTION
When removing a PCI I/O card, do not rock it from side to side, or the card
may be damaged.
NOTE
Prior to removing the PCI I/O cards, the Left Side Panel and the Air Divider
need to be removed. See the appropriate section(s) for the steps to remove and
replace these components.
1. Looking down on the PCI I/O cards, remove the bulkhead screw for each PCI I/O card.
Figure 2-16. Removing the PCI I/O Cards' Bulkhead Screws
2. Grasp the edges of each PCI I/O card and pull it up and out of the workstation.
